Does Canon M50 Mark II Have Bluetooth?

Roy

Yes, the Canon M50 Mark II has built-in Bluetooth connectivity, which allows you to quickly transfer images and videos to your smartphone or tablet for quick sharing.

This feature is available through the Canon Camera Connect app, which is available for both iOS and Android devices. To use the Bluetooth connection, simply enable Bluetooth on both your Camera and your mobile device, and then pair the two devices using the Camera Connect app.

With the Bluetooth connection, you can also use your mobile device as a remote control for the Camera. This allows you to control the Camera from a distance, adjust settings, and even trigger the shutter release remotely. This is especially useful for taking group photos or for taking pictures in hard-to-reach places, such as high up or in low-light conditions.

In addition to Bluetooth, the Canon M50 Mark II also has built-in Wi-Fi connectivity, which allows you to transfer images and videos to your computer and control the Camera from a computer using the Canon EOS Utility app. The Wi-Fi connectivity also enables you to upload pictures and videos to your favorite social media sites and to share your photos and videos with friends and family.
